The name of the process where an organism develops from a single cell into many different types of cells is called "cell differentiation." This process involves cells becoming specialized to perform specific functions in the body, leading to the formation of different tissues and organs.

False. A point mutation is a change in a single nucleotide of DNA, leading to a change in the protein encoded by that gene. The failure of a chromosome pair to separate during mitosis is known as nondisjunction, which can lead to chromosomal abnormalities in the daughter cells.
